My 106 Predictions:

Tito Ortiz vs. Forrest Griffin - I really dont know who to pick in this fight. Tito hasnt fought in a longgg time but is completely healthy following his back surgery. Forrest has the better standup but i dont think its good enough to completely dominate Tito. TIto is the better wrestler and if he can get takedowns can do some damage and control Forrest. Im gonna take Tito here for old times sake, I really think he can get back to being a top 10 LHW again.

Josh Koscheck vs. Anthony Johnson - Koscheck needs to realise hes not a boxer, His standup is powerful but very basic and if he tries to trade with the power of Johnson he will go out. Kos needs the takedowns to get the win. I see Johnson winning this fight, I think he can stuff atleast some of the takedowns, with his strength and size and I see him KO'ing Kos in the 2nd.

Antonio Rogerio Nogueira vs. Luis Arthur Cane - Will be really interesting to see how Rogerio goes, He hasnt fought good competition in quite a while and Cane is a legit top 10 LHW. Rogerio actually made the Brazillian olympic team in boxing, so like his brother, has really really solid boxing. Cane has the more powerful and dynamic standup however, so it will be interesting to see how they clash on the feet. I have a feeling it will stay standing until someone gets hurt. Even though Nog has a adavantage on the ground. I think we will see a very exciting and close decision for Cane.

Dustin Hazelett vs. Karo Parisyan - I love watching Hazelett fight, Neither have a hell of alot of standup but Hazeletts jiu jitsu will be too good for Karo, Even hes on his back i see him getting Karo in a submission.

Amir Sadollah vs. Phil Baroni - Baroni is a joke, If he doesnt knock you out in the 1st minute hes done and dusted. Sadollah by 1st round armbar.

Marcus Davis vs. Ben Saunders - Davis is a good technical boxer, But Saunders will have reach and size in this fight and is the better ground fighter. I think it will go 2 possible ways, They both stand up and Davis gets the better of Saunders or Saunders takes Davis down and maybe even submits him. I'm gonna go with Saunders by decision.

Paulo Thiago vs. Jacob Volkmann - Thiago has had some big fights early in his UFC career, I dont know much about Volkmann so i gotta go with Thiago, 1st round TKO.

Kendall Grove vs. Jake Rosholt - Rosholt is a legit wrestler and has been showing some good hands lately but still gets hit alot. I think hes gonna test his hands again though. But once he gets hit he'll go back to his base and get takedowns for a decision win.

Brock Larson vs. Brian Foster - A pretty mehh fight. I see Larson getting the takedowns and riding out a decision.

Caol Uno vs. Fabricio Camoes - For those who dont know Camoes, He is a reallly good prospect and i wouldnt be surprised if he won. Uno is a veteran though and fighting in the UFC for the 1st time might affect Camoes, And i think Uno can avoid any submissions from Camoes, I got Uno by decision.

George Sotiropoulos vs. Jason Dent - Gotta go with George here, He is a better ground fighter than Dent and as long as he can get it there he should get a sub early.
